The Rise of Real-World Asset Tokenization

Real-world asset tokenization represents a fundamental shift in how physical commodities are owned and traded on public blockchains. According to Abhishek Bindlish, Senior Director Analyst at Gartner, “Tokenization is poised to transform how real-world assets are owned, traded and managed by enabling fractional ownership and greater liquidity through blockchain-based representations” (Gartner, 2024)[4]. This transformation is particularly evident in agricultural assets, where digital tokens allow global investors to purchase fractional shares of physical harvests. The infrastructure supporting this shift is expanding rapidly, with the number of public blockchains hosting tokenized real-world asset projects growing to 19 networks by Q4 2024 (Chainalysis, 2024)[5].

When a physical asset is tokenized, a digital ledger records the ownership, providing cryptographic security that prevents double-spending and ensures a transparent transaction history. The specific token standard used, such as ERC-721 for unique lots or ERC-20 for fungible batches, dictates how the asset behaves on-chain. Legal and Logistical Frameworks

Establishing robust legal and logistical frameworks is the most critical challenge in tokenizing physical commodities. A digital token must have a legally binding link to the physical asset it represents. If a storage facility experiences a loss, the legal structure must dictate how token holders are compensated. This requires specialized insurance and legal wrappers, such as special purpose vehicles or trusts, to hold the physical asset on behalf of token holders. The complexity of this task is reflected in industry surveys, where 63 percent of financial institutions cited legal and regulatory uncertainty as the top barrier to adopting real-world asset tokenization (ISDA, 2024)[7].

A comprehensive coffeebeancrypto guide must address jurisdictional differences in property law. A token issued in one country might not be recognized as a valid claim to physical goods in another, complicating cross-border commodity trading. Furthermore, the logistics of physical delivery require a network of trusted custodians who perform regular audits to ensure the physical inventory matches the on-chain supply. This intersection of digital ledger technology and traditional property law is where the true innovation lies, moving the industry beyond mere speculation into tangible utility backed by verifiable asset backing.

Market Growth and Institutional Adoption

Institutional adoption is accelerating the growth of tokenized commodity markets, driven by the demand for yield and portfolio diversification. Real-world asset tokenization platforms raised 1.2 billion US dollars in venture funding across 2024 (PitchBook, 2024)[8], signaling strong investor confidence in the sector’s long-term viability. This confidence is bolstered by the success of tokenized fiat and government debt; for instance, on-chain tokenized US Treasury products surpassed 1.6 billion US dollars in assets under management as of February 2025 (RWA.xyz, 2025)[9].

As institutional comfort with digital assets grows, capital is increasingly flowing into physical commodities. Matthew Sigel, Head of Digital Assets Research at VanEck, states, “We think the tokenization of commodities and other real assets will be a multi-trillion-dollar opportunity over the next decade as infrastructure, regulation and investor comfort all mature” (VanEck, 2025)[10]. How does tokenization improve agricultural supply chains?

Tokenization enhances supply chains by providing an immutable record of an asset’s journey from farm to consumer. Smart contracts automate payments and transfer ownership transparently, reducing the need for intermediaries. This digital ledger traceability verifies certifications, ensures fair compensation for farmers, and allows buyers to confirm the exact origin and quality of the physical goods they are purchasing.

What are the main legal barriers to real-world asset tokenization?

The main legal barriers include regulatory uncertainty and the challenge of linking digital tokens to physical property rights across different jurisdictions. Financial institutions often struggle with defining the legal status of a token and ensuring that token holders have enforceable claims to the underlying physical assets in the event of custodian default or bankruptcy.

Can retail investors participate in tokenized commodity markets?

Yes, retail investors can participate through decentralized finance protocols and specialized tokenization platforms. By purchasing fractional tokens, individuals can gain exposure to commodity trading without needing to buy, store, or transport the physical goods. However, investors must conduct thorough due diligence on the platform’s custodial arrangements, audit practices, and the legal structure backing the digital tokens.

Practical Tips

When engaging with tokenized agricultural assets, following best practices ensures security and compliance. First, always verify the custodial arrangements. Ensure that the physical assets are held in audited, insured warehouses by reputable third parties. Second, review the smart contract code or rely on platforms that have undergone rigorous third-party security audits to prevent vulnerabilities. Third, understand the legal wrapper. Read the terms of service to confirm how property rights are enforced in your specific jurisdiction.

Fourth, monitor the on-chain and off-chain data oracles. These systems must accurately reflect the physical inventory to prevent discrepancies between the digital token supply and the actual physical harvest. Finally, diversify your holdings across different commodity batches and geographic regions to mitigate localized agricultural risks, such as weather events or supply chain disruptions.
